Dealing with Damp and Mould at the Source
You know there’s a problem with moisture in the air once we start to see condensation and black mould forming in a property. Reminding tenants to open windows will help manage the symptoms, but they won’t make them go away. By using mechanical refrigeration, the Ebac LMD system deals with the problem at the source.
It works by pulling humid air into the loft unit. The air is drawn through the unit's evaporator coils where moisture is condensed, collected, and removed through a drain.
At National Heater Shops, we like to remind customers of the latent heat that is created during this process. This dry, heated air is then sent back through the property, keeping walls and windows warm enough to stop the dew points where condensation forms.
Supporting Awaab’s Law
It is now a legal requirement that mould and damp are dealt with swiftly in social housing. Awaab’s Law (Social Housing Regulation Act 2023) states that landlords must deal with these issues within set timelines or face legal action.
